I want to use them and daytime running lights. I thought about connecting them to the park lights but its a two wire system so they would flash when the turn signals work. I was hoping I could use the cooling fan but its hot all the time, even with ignition off. I dont see an easy way to run one from the glovebox fuse box.
Check the relay box under the hood (passenger side). There is a wire in there. I believe it's red/yellow. VERIFY THAT FIRST though. I have my halos triggered by the interior lights, and then the relay switches over to +12v from under hood input upon starting the vehicle.

Keep in mind mine is an LCI (04-06) model, but I think that wire should be present on earlier versions too.
